The Antminer S17 Pro: Does Yet Viable in this Year?

Despite reaching legacy status, the Antminer S17 Pro stays a surprisingly useful option for some users in 2024. While more recent devices offer much greater hash outputs, the S17 Pro's relatively affordable cost and presence on bitmain antminer s17 the pre-owned market make it interesting for those wanting to get started Bitcoin mining into a small budget. However, remember its higher power draw and potentially decreased earnings compared to current generation miners.

Optimizing Your Antminer S17+ for Peak Mining Power

To unlock the full potential of your Bitmain S17 Pro, careful optimization is essential . Numerous factors impact hash rate, and addressing them can generate impressive gains. Start by verifying adequate cooling ; overheating considerably reduces efficiency. Clean debris from the cooling system regularly – obstructed airflow is a common culprit. Test with slight undervolting – decreasing the voltage can improve efficiency, but carefully monitor temperature to prevent damage . Finally, maintain the newest firmware version, as revisions often feature mining improvements. Consider a reliable power supply – inconsistencies can negatively affect hash rate.
